Who doesn’t love a cute turtle?! This easy paper mache craft is perfect for kids aged 5 to 99. Homemade paper mache paste and recycled newspapers makes it cheap and fun. All you need is a balloon and a couple of days for drying…..

You will need:
Paper mache paste
Newspaper strips
White paint
Colored Tissue paper
School glue
Google eyes
Yellow craft foam

Let’s get started:

Step 1: Cover bottom half of small balloon with paper mache paste and newspaper strips. Let dry overnight. Repeat three times.

Step 2:
Remove the paper mache shell and trim top to make it smooth.

Step 3: Paint the turtle shell white and then cover with tissue paper and diluted school glue.

Step 4:
Cut out head, legs and tail from yellow craft foam. Glue onto the shell with hot glue and add eyes.
